PURIFICATION AND CHARACTERIZATION OF RECOMBINANT Bacillus aquimaris MKSC 6.2 ?-AMYLASE EXPRESSED In Escherichia coli ArcticExpress (DE3)
?-Amylase (E.C 3.2.1.1) catalyzes the hydrolysis of internal ?-1,4-glycosidic linkages in starch. An ?-amylase from Bacillus aquimaris BaqA can degrade raw starch despite having no starch binding domain (SBD) which is commonly presence in the known raw starch degrading enzymes.
